5 Key Trends Shaping the Future of Office Design in Manila
Drawing on our extensive experience and deep understanding of local business culture, here’s what we see shaping the next generation of workplaces:
🌿 Biophilic Design: Bringing Nature Into the Urban Heart
Manila’s fast pace and dense skyline can feel overwhelming. That’s why we’re integrating more natural elements into office interiors—indoor plants, green walls, wooden finishes, and water features that echo the serenity of places like Baguio or Tagaytay.
These biophilic touches aren’t just decorative—they reduce stress, improve air quality, and create a calming atmosphere where employees can thrive.

💡 Flexible, Hybrid-Ready Layouts
With hybrid work now a permanent fixture, offices must be designed for agility. We’re moving away from fixed desks and rigid cubicles toward modular furniture, convertible zones, and smart booking systems.
In a recent project for a tech startup in Bonifacio Global City, we created a floor plan with hot-desking stations, quiet pods for focus, and open lounges for collaboration—ensuring the space could adapt to any work mode.
This flexibility not only supports productivity but also makes the office a destination worth returning to.
🎨 Culturally Rooted Aesthetics
The best office designs in Manila don’t just look good—they feel familiar. We incorporate local materials like capiz shell, abaca weave, and hand-carved wood to create interiors that resonate with Filipino identity.
From warm earth tones to subtle nods to traditional bahay kubo architecture, these details make employees feel seen and valued.
In Makati, we recently designed a co-working space with woven rattan partitions and a central sala-style lounge—creating a welcoming, home-like environment for freelancers and remote teams.
🔌 Smart Technology Integration
Modern offices in Manila are getting smarter. We integrate voice-controlled lighting, app-based room bookings, and AI-powered climate systems to streamline operations and enhance comfort.
These technologies aren’t about flashiness—they’re about creating intuitive environments where employees can work efficiently without friction.
☕ Social Zones That Foster Connection
The future of work is human. That’s why we’re designing more spaces for connection—tea corners inspired by sari-sari stores, coffee nooks, and communal tables where teams can gather, share ideas, and build relationships.
In a world where digital communication dominates, these physical touchpoints are more important than ever.

Case Study: A Corporate Office Refresh in Makati
One of our recent clients was a financial services firm looking to modernize its aging office in Ayala Avenue. Their goals were clear: attract younger talent, support hybrid work, and reflect a more progressive brand image.
We transformed the space with:
- Open-plan layouts and flexible workstations
- Biophilic elements like indoor gardens and natural wood finishes
- A central wellness zone with a tea bar and quiet pods
- Brand-aligned colors and locally inspired art
The result? A 40% increase in employee satisfaction and a noticeable boost in client engagement during in-person meetings.
